During the April 23, 2025 meeting the Senate Education Committee conducted work sessions and recorded floor‑referral roll calls for three bills. Each motion was recorded as passed and the committee named carriers for floor action.
House Bill 2421 — direct admissions participation
Vice Chair Senator Weber moved HB 2421 to the floor with a due‑pass recommendation. The committee recorded a roll call with the following recorded votes: Senator Wilson Blue — Aye; Senator Robinson — Aye; Senator Sullivan — Aye; Vice Chair Weber — Aye; Chair Frederick — Aye. The motion passed. Chair Frederick said he would serve as carrier unless another senator volunteered; Senator Frederick then indicated he would carry the bill.
House Bill 2,551 — background checks for special campus security officers
Senator Weber moved HB 2,551 to the floor with a due‑pass recommendation. Committee questions about fiscal impact were addressed in advance with the Legislative Fiscal Office and the Department of Public Safety Standards and Training; testimony reported minimal impact but noted the agency would need to justify any later requests for additional positions with data. Roll call recorded: Senator Gelser — Aye; Senator Robinson — Aye; Senator Sullivan — Aye; Vice Chair Glover — Aye; Chair Frederick — Aye. The motion passed. Senator Weber agreed to be the carrier.
House Bill 3,063 — hospital education program residency
Senator Weber moved HB 3,063 to the floor with a due‑pass recommendation. Senators discussed potential operational issues and ODE said the bill has minimal fiscal impact. Roll call recorded: Senator Gelser — Aye; Senator Robinson — Aye; Senator Sullivan — Aye; Vice Chair Weber — Aye; Chair Frederick — Aye. The motion passed. Senator Robinson agreed to carry the bill on the floor.
Each motion passed on committee voice/roll calls recorded in the hearing record; the transcript does not record any negative votes, abstentions or detailed vote tallies beyond the roll calls cited above.
